JEDEC cooks up chunky new DDR5 standard
Published in News
Friday, 21 November 2025 10:34

JEDEC cooks up chunky new DDR5 standard


Quad-rank CKDs promise fatter modules for next-gen desktops

JEDEC is hammering out a CQDIMM standard for DDR5 CKD memory that will let future platforms cram in far higher capacities without slowing everything to a crawl.

Nanya says DDR4 shortage is helping it rake it in
Published in PC Hardware


Memory factory finds profit in what others abandoned

The general manager of Nanya Technology, Li Peiying, reckons there’s still life in the old DDR4 market, especially now that the big players have moved on and left a gap wide enough to drive a lorry through.
